L887 PWU is a 1994 Isuzu Trooper in Grey with a 3,165c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 5 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60%.
Across all 1994 Isuzu Trooper models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.9% with a typical mileage of 137,788 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Isuzu Trooper f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 28,164 recorded failures. If you're considering buying L887 PWU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Isuzu Trooper typically stays on UK roads for around 38 years. At 32 years old, this Isuzu Trooper is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
